What is the axis of symmetry for this function?
y=x2 - 2x - 3
.

Answers

That will be 1 :)))))))))))))))

Answer:

x=1

Step-by-step explanation:

You can find the axis of symmetry from the equation of a function by using the formula x= -b / 2a          ( ax^2 + bx + c).

In this particular function, you can see that b is 1 and c is -3.

x= -b / 2a

x= - (-2) / 2(1)

x= 2 / 1

x= 1

Grandma received 0.25 liters of medicine from her doctor. The directions asked her to take one teaspoonful 3 times daily until it is finished. A full teaspoon has a capacity of 4 ml. Grandma started taking her medicine on November 20th. What date should the medicine finish?

Answers

Answer:

Dec 10

Step-by-step explanation:

0.25 liter = 250 ml

4 ml * 3 = 12 ml

250/12 = 20.83 days

Nov 20 - Nov 30: 11 days

Dec 1 - Dec 9: 9 days

On December 9, she can still take her 3 doses.

By December 9, she will have taken 12 ml per day for 20 days for a total of 240 ml. She has 10 ml left for Dec 10th.

On Dec 10, she will take 2 doses of 4 ml and 1 dose of 2 ml, and she will finish the medicine.
